Chapter 3

I woke up with the sunshine burning my eyes. I checked my phone, I had 13 missed calls all from Keaton, I slept right through every single one of them. Even if I was awake, I wouldn't pick up, no matter what his explanation for all of this was. He had kissed the girl that I hate, and didn't even pull back. I stayed in bed all morning, and when I finally decided to drag my lazy butt up, I was home alone. I looked out my window, no cars in the driveway, it was only me and my fluffy golden retriever named Max.

I walked to my bathroom that was connected to my room and kind of just stared at my reflection for what seemed like hours. I watched a tear roll down my cheek, drip off my face and onto the floor. I looked like a mess. My hair was thrown into a messy bun, I had mascara all around my eyes, and it looked like I had two black eyes. I was in a light pink tank top, and really baggy black sweatpants from Victorias Secret that said PINK in white letters down the side.

I turned on the shower all the way on the hot side, and stripped all my clothes off. I stepped into the shower, still too cold, so I was kind of trapped into the corner with cold air spraying up into my face. It finally got warm enough to where I could step under the water, and when I did, let me tell you that it felt so good. I shampooed and conditioned my hair, washed my body with my new Victoria's Secret body wash, shaved my legs and armpits and just stood under the water for about a half hour, I couldn't get out. The heat felt so good, and I couldn't get enough, but I figured I should probably do other stuff today, and I got out of the shower, feeling the cool air touch my body as I wrap my towel around myself. I towel dry my hair a little bit, and dry off my body. I walked back to my room, and got dressed in light wash skinny jeans and I too big t-shirt for me.

I grab my phone, and walk downstairs to get myself a late breakfast. I looked in all of the cupboards, and saw Brown Sugar Poptarts. I put two in the toaster, and impatiently wait of them to pop. Soon enough, they did.

I eat my breakfast in front of the TV watching the replay of Pretty Little Liars that I missed last Tuesday. It was over after about an hour, and I was done with my Pop tarts. I just had a plate, with a few crumbs on it. I get up, and still wonder where my family is. I get out my phone, I had another 2 missed calls from Keaton. My phone must've been on silent or something.

I push speed dial number 2, and my mom answers with the first two rings. "Hey sweetie! Finally awake?"

"Yes, and I'm showered too. Where are you?" I asked, waiting for an answer.

"Erica, we tried to wake you up this morning at about 10 o'clock. You didn't even move, so I figured you weren't going to get up. Your father, your sister and me went to breakfast and shopping. We're on our way home now. Guess who we saw?" She said.

"Who??"

"Keaton!" She said excitedly.

But I lost it. I cried again. I couldn't even stand hearing his name out loud with out breaking down into tears.

"What's wrong babe?" I hated when she called me babe, but I didn't have the guts to tell her, she's been calling me that for years.

"I don't want to talk about it right now." I sobbed. "Maybe when you get home." I hung up.

When I hung up, I looked out the window on my deck. And guess who was standing there? Keaton.
